The Pixie Powerhouse: Reimagined & Refined
The pixie cut, a timeless classic, remains a cornerstone of short hairstyles in 2025. However, expect to see a departure from the strictly uniform pixies of the past. This year’s iteration embraces texture and subtle asymmetry. Think wispy, face-framing layers that add softness and movement, contrasting with longer, choppy sections at the crown for added volume and a touch of rebelliousness.
- The Textured Pixie: This style utilizes a variety of cutting techniques to create a multi-dimensional look. Razor cutting and point cutting are key to achieving the wispy texture, while layering adds depth and movement. Styling is effortless, relying on texturizing products like sea salt spray or mousse to enhance the natural texture.
- The Asymmetrical Pixie: Breaking the mold of symmetry, the asymmetrical pixie features longer sections on one side of the face, often swept behind the ear or styled to create a dramatic contrast. This style is perfect for adding an edge to a classic cut, and it works particularly well for those with strong facial features.
- The Long Pixie: Blurring the lines between a pixie and a bob, the long pixie features longer layers at the nape of the neck and around the ears, offering versatility in styling. It can be styled sleek and straight, tousled and textured, or even pulled back into a mini-ponytail.
The Modern Bob: Evolution of a Classic
The bob, another timeless staple, undergoes a sophisticated evolution in 2025. Gone are the blunt, one-length bobs of yesteryear; this year’s bobs are all about subtle variations and playful details.
- The Blunt Bob with a Twist: While maintaining the clean lines of a classic blunt bob, 2025 sees the addition of subtle details like micro-bangs, a slightly angled cut, or a subtle internal layering to add movement without sacrificing the sharp silhouette. This style is sleek, sophisticated, and effortlessly chic.
- The Textured Lob (Long Bob): The lob continues to reign supreme, but with a focus on texture. This style incorporates layers and waves to create a relaxed, beachy vibe. Styling is effortless, achieved with a simple air-dry or a quick wave with a curling iron.
- The A-Line Bob: This style features shorter layers at the back and longer layers at the front, creating a flattering A-line shape that accentuates the cheekbones and jawline. It’s a versatile cut that can be styled sleek and straight or with soft waves.
Beyond the Basics: Exploring Unique Short Haircuts
2025 embraces individuality, pushing the boundaries of traditional short haircuts with bold and experimental styles.
- The Undercut: This daring style features shaved or closely cropped sides and back, contrasted with longer hair on top. This offers a high-fashion, edgy look that can be customized to suit individual preferences. The longer top section can be styled in various ways, from a slicked-back look to textured waves or a sculpted quiff.
- The Bowl Cut (Reimagined): The bowl cut, once considered a childhood staple, makes a surprising comeback in 2025, but with a modern twist. Instead of a harsh, blunt cut, the modern bowl cut incorporates subtle layering and texturizing to soften the overall look. This adds movement and prevents the cut from appearing too severe.
- The Curly Pixie/Bob: Women with naturally curly or coily hair are embracing short cuts like never before. The curly pixie and bob are gaining popularity, showcasing the beauty of natural texture. These cuts focus on enhancing the curl pattern, creating a voluminous and dynamic look. Strategic layering helps to define the curls and prevent them from looking too bulky.
Color & Texture: Enhancing Your Short Style
The haircut itself is only half the equation. Color and texture play crucial roles in completing the look and enhancing the overall impact of your short style in 2025.
- Dimensional Color: Multi-tonal coloring techniques, like balayage, ombre, and highlights, are essential for adding depth and dimension to short hair. These techniques create a natural-looking sun-kissed effect, enhancing the movement and texture of the cut.
- Rich, Deep Tones: Bold, saturated colors, such as deep reds, rich browns, and intense blacks, are making a statement in 2025. These colors add drama and sophistication to short haircuts, creating a powerful and unforgettable look.
- Textured Finishes: Texturizing products are key to achieving the desired look and feel for your short style. From sea salt sprays for a tousled, beachy vibe to pomades for a sleek, polished finish, the right product can transform your look.
Choosing the Right Short Haircut for You:
Selecting the perfect short haircut involves considering several factors:
- Face Shape: Certain cuts complement specific face shapes better than others. A consultation with a stylist can help determine the most flattering style for your facial features.
- Hair Texture: Fine hair may require different layering techniques than thick or coarse hair. Your stylist can help you choose a cut that maximizes your hair’s natural texture.
- Lifestyle: Consider your lifestyle and how much time you’re willing to dedicate to styling your hair. Some cuts require more maintenance than others.
- Personal Style: Ultimately, the best short haircut is one that reflects your personality and makes you feel confident and comfortable.
Maintaining Your Short Style:
Once you’ve found the perfect short haircut, maintaining it is crucial to keep it looking its best. Regular trims (every 4-6 weeks) are essential to prevent the style from becoming shaggy or uneven. Using the right styling products and techniques will also help you achieve the desired look each day. Don’t hesitate to consult your stylist for advice on maintaining your specific cut and style.
